1) What does "Boost Technology" have to do with conquering the ADSL/fibre market? I have no idea what you think "Boost Technology" is... since technically it's just time based rate limiting...
2) Economy of scale - TIME would be stupid if they tried to cover only houses instead of condos/apartments. Spend $10 to cover 500 people, or spend $10 to cover 1 person. Hmm...

v24 preSP2 build 14896 on my WNDR3700 biggrin.gif


Added on August 6, 2012, 10:51 pmRouter Specifications

CPU: AR7161 680 MHz
RAM: 64 MB
Flash: 8 MB (16 MB on v2)
Switch: Realtek RTL8366SR
Radio (2.4 GHz): AR9223
Radio (5 GHz): AR9220
Antenna Type: Internal
# Of Antennas: 8
Antenna Gain (2.4 GHz): 2.8 dBi
Antenna Gain (5 GHz): 3.9 dBi
Max TX Power (2.4 GHz): 17dBm
Max TX Power (5 GHz): 24dBm
Antenna Chains (TX/RX): 1+2/1+2
